The Demon King's Daughter's Lament
In the realm of the Immortals, where celestial powers danced with the very essence of existence, there lived a creature of both awe and dread—the Demon King. His daughter, Elara, was a paradox of her father's dark legacy and her own inherent purity. With eyes that held the stars and hair that shimmered with the light of a thousand moons, Elara was the embodiment of contradiction.
Elara had grown up amidst the shadows of her father's court, learning the arcane arts and the ways of the dark. Yet, within her heart, there beat a different rhythm—a longing for the light, for the freedom that only love could provide. It was this love that led her to a mortal realm, where she met Aiden, a knight with a heart as pure as the white snow that blanketed the mountains of their land.
As the seasons changed and their love grew, Elara found herself torn between her duties as the Demon King's daughter and her love for Aiden. She knew that the two could never coexist, for the balance of the realms was at stake. The Demon King had forbidden any form of attachment, for fear that Elara's heart might sway him toward the light.
One fateful night, as the moon hung low in the sky, a figure slipped through the veils of the mortal realm. It was the Demon King's greatest enemy, a sorcerer who had once been banished but had returned with a twisted purpose. He sought to claim the Demon King's throne and bring an end to the Immortal World.
The sorcerer's arrival was a prelude to a storm of chaos. He cast a dark spell that would shatter the veil between the realms, allowing the taint of darkness to seep into the mortal world. In a fit of rage and fear, the Demon King ordered Elara to kill Aiden, believing that his love was the only thing standing in the way of his reign.
Elara, torn between her father's command and her love for Aiden, found herself at the crossroads of her destiny. She could obey her father and protect the Immortal World, or she could defy him and risk everything for Aiden.
As the sorcerer's forces closed in, Elara knew that she had to make a choice. She whispered Aiden's name to the winds, feeling the power of their love course through her veins. With a heart heavy with sorrow, she decided to defy her father.
She summoned her magic, a blend of her father's dark arts and the light that had always danced within her. The sorcerer's dark aura was pushed back, and the balance of the realms was restored. The Demon King, witnessing the love that had transformed his daughter, realized the error of his ways.
In the aftermath, Elara and Aiden were no longer just lovers; they were the protectors of both realms. The Demon King, humbled and enlightened, forgave his daughter, acknowledging the light that had always resided within her.
But the peace was fleeting. The sorcerer, still plotting revenge, had left a mark on the fabric of reality. Elara and Aiden knew that their love would be tested time and again, and that the fate of the Immortal World rested in their hands.
The Demon King's Daughter's Lament was a tale of love, betrayal, and redemption. It was a story that spoke of the power of the heart and the resilience of the soul. And as the stars twinkled above, Elara and Aiden stood together, ready to face whatever challenges lay ahead, hand in hand, heart to heart.
